Pipeline stress experts generally do pipeline anxiety evaluation using the dirt strength values supplied by geotechnical designers. These worths suggest the stress and anxiety level the dirt can tolerate without undergoing extreme contortions.

Overestimating the load-bearing capacity too much can result in too much deformation or also failure of the pipe in extreme conditions. On the other hand, ignoring the soil's load-bearing capability can lead to making use of an overdesigned pipeline. In situations where pipe failures do happen, forensic geotechnical designers investigate whether the dirt stamina was assessed appropriately and whether the style group overestimated the load-bearing capacity of the soils in the pipeline area.

Each terrain presents particular difficulties for the layout and building of the pipeline. Since the design of pipes requires to be constant with the geologic terrain, the shear strength of the dirt is a vital consider examining pipe motion on sloping areas. On the other hand, soil dilatancy (the tendency of soil to broaden when sheared) must be made up in seismic zones to stop extreme anxieties on the pipeline throughout an earthquake.

If these two teams fall short to connect successfully, misjudgments regarding dirt stamina or pipe load-bearing capability might lead to unexpected pipeline failings. Overstated soil toughness specifications, as an example, may lead tension experts to under-design a pipeline for the variety of forces used to it during its life expectancy. Conversely, where the soil is thought to be weak than it actually is, the pipeline might be overdesigned, leading to unneeded costs and more rigidity.
